相关文章
二十三种设计模式-工厂方法模式
工厂方法模式是一种创建型设计模式,其核心思想是通过定义一个创建对象的接口,让子类决定实例化哪一个类。工厂方法模式将对象的实例化推迟到子类中进行,从而使得扩展变得容易,而不需要修改现有的代码,符合开闭原则&…
建站知识
2025/1/4 2:10:57
SpringBoot发邮件(带附件)
1、需求
每个月月初需要对各部门的项目预算、进度、金额使用情况进行统计,统计完成后将报表通过邮件发送到指定的领导邮箱,项目基于SpringBoot实现,那就找SpringBoot发邮件的组件吧
2、找解决办法
通过在bing.cn搜索SpringBoot发邮件带附件…
建站知识
2025/1/4 3:30:08
uniapp Stripe 支付
引入 Stripe npm install stripe/stripe-js import { loadStripe } from stripe/stripe-js;
Stripe 提供两种不同类型组件
Payment Element 和 Card Element:如果你使用的是 Payment Element,它是一个更高级别的组件,能够自动处理多种支…
建站知识
2025/1/4 18:45:48
chatgpt model spec 2024
概述
这是模型规范的初稿,该文档规定了我们在OpenAI API和ChatGPT中的模型的期望行为。它包括一组核心目标,以及关于如何处理冲突目标或指令的指导。 我们打算将模型规范作为研究人员和数据标注者创建数据的指南,这是一种称为从人类反馈中进…
建站知识
2025/1/4 17:41:36
Unity Mesh生成Cube
1. 配置一个Cube的每个面的数据 一共是6个面,每个面包含的数据包括4个顶点的相对顶点坐标(Cube的中心为原点),法线方向,UV坐标,顶点渲染顺序,以及这个面用到的材质,因为这里是Top&am…
建站知识
2025/1/5 7:18:37
Kafka消息不丢失与重复消费问题解决方案总结
1. 生产者层面 异步发送与回调处理
异步发送方式:生产者一般使用异步方式发送消息,异步发送有消息和回调接口两个参数。在回调接口的重写方法中,可通过异常参数判断消息发送状态。若消息发送成功,异常参数为null;若发…
建站知识
2025/1/2 22:27:07
密码学原理技术-第七章-The RSA Cryptosystem
文章目录 总结The RSA CryptosystemEncryption and DecryptionExample: RSA with small numbersKey Generation Implementation aspectsSquare-and-MultiplyComplexity of Square-and-Multiply Alg.Fast encryption with small public exponentFast decryption with CRTBasic p…
建站知识
2025/1/5 1:55:38